在本申請中,介質可以為紙張、膠膜、木片、金屬片等可供印刷的任意物體,介質表面可被印刷包含文字、圖像等主要資訊,且還可被印刷有一種或多種類型的圖像指標,如圖2a所示,任一類型的圖像指標包括標頭部201以及內容資料部202,標頭部由多個微圖像單元2011構成,其中微圖像單元2011可包括點狀圖案,標頭部中的點狀團分佈位置可不對稱,標頭部用於得到完整圖像指標,並識別不同圖像指標;而內容資料部202也由多個微圖像單元2021構成,其中微圖像單元2021可包括點狀圖案,其中點狀圖案排列規則不同於標頭部,與標頭部201的點狀圖案組成矩形陣列,用於表示圖像指標的數位資料。 In the present application, the medium can be any printable object such as paper, film, wood chip, metal sheet, etc. The surface of the medium can be printed with main information including text, images, etc., and can also be printed with one or more types of image indicators. As shown in FIG. 2a, any type of image indicator includes a header portion 201 and a content data portion 202. The header portion is composed of a plurality of micro-image units 2011, wherein the micro-image unit 2011 can include The header part includes a dot pattern, and the dot clusters in the header part may be asymmetrically distributed. The header part is used to obtain a complete image pointer and identify different image pointers. The content data part 202 is also composed of a plurality of micro-image units 2021, wherein the micro-image unit 2021 may include a dot pattern, wherein the arrangement rule of the dot pattern is different from that of the header part, and the dot pattern of the header part 201 forms a rectangular array, which is used to represent the digital data of the image pointer.

而介質表面承載有一種或多種類型的圖像指標,不同類型的圖像指標之間的微圖像單元排列規則有所不同,其中不同類型的圖像指標的標頭部的微圖像單元排列規則可以不同,例如不同類型的圖像指標的標 頭部可以分別為“L”型和“7”型,如圖2a和圖2b所示的不同類型的圖像指標的標頭部201和201';和/或,不同類型的圖像指標的尺寸(矩形陣列的維度)也可以不同,例如不同類型的圖像指標可以分別為4×4、4×5與5×5,通過改變標頭部的微圖像單元排列規則和/或圖像指標的尺寸,可以組合出不同類型的圖像指標;此外,不同類型的圖像指標的內容資料部,如圖2a和圖2b所示的不同類型的圖像指標的內容資料部202和202',微圖像單元排列規則可以相同,也可以不同。 The medium surface carries one or more types of image pointers, and the arrangement rules of the micro-image units of the image pointers of different types are different, wherein the arrangement rules of the micro-image units of the headers of the image pointers of different types may be different, for example, the headers of the image pointers of different types may be "L"-shaped and "7"-shaped, respectively, as shown in FIG. 2a and FIG. 2b, the headers 201 and 201' of the image pointers of different types; and/or, the sizes (rectangles) of the image pointers of different types may be different. The dimensions of the image pointers (e.g., different types of image pointers) may also be different. For example, different types of image pointers may be 4×4, 4×5, and 5×5. By changing the arrangement rules of the micro-image units in the header and/or the size of the image pointer, different types of image pointers may be combined. In addition, the content data parts of different types of image pointers, such as the content data parts 202 and 202' of different types of image pointers shown in FIG. 2a and FIG. 2b, may have the same or different micro-image unit arrangement rules.

具體的,不同類型的圖像指標的標頭部的微圖像單元排列規則中包括共通排列規則和非共通排列規則,在從介質表面圖像識別第一標頭部時,可以先以不同類型的圖像指標的標頭部的共通排列規則找出標頭部的第一部分,在標頭部的第一部分的基礎上,再以不同類型的圖像指標的標頭部的非共通排列規則,找出標頭部剩餘的第二部分,從而得到完整的第一標頭部,而依據找出第一標頭部所用到的排列規則,可以確定出第 一圖像指標的類型。 Specifically, the arrangement rules of the micro-image units in the headers of different types of image pointers include common arrangement rules and non-common arrangement rules. When identifying the first header from the medium surface image, the first part of the header can be found out by using the common arrangement rules of the headers of different types of image pointers. Based on the first part of the header, the remaining second part of the header can be found out by using the non-common arrangement rules of the headers of different types of image pointers, thereby obtaining the complete first header. Based on the arrangement rules used to find the first header, the type of the first image pointer can be determined.

例如對於圖2a和圖2b中“L”型和“7”型二種不同排列規則的標頭部的圖像指標,解碼時先找出符合共通排列規則的第一部分的標頭部:“─”型排列的點狀圖案;在識別出第一部分的標頭部的基礎上,再以非共通排列規則找出第二部份的標頭部,如果是滿足“|”型排列,則該標頭部為“L”型標頭部,從而確定第一圖像指標為“L”型標頭部的圖像指標,如果是滿足“/”型排列,則該標頭部為“7”型標頭部,從而確定第一圖像指標為“7”型標頭部的圖像指標。進一步的,可基於第一圖像指標的標頭部的微圖像單元排列規則,以及標頭部的點狀圖案數量確認第一圖像指標的尺寸,即可決定第一圖像指標的類型,並依據第一圖像指標的類型對應的內容資料部的排列規則完成解碼。 For example, for the image pointers of the headers with two different arrangement rules of "L" type and "7" type in Figure 2a and Figure 2b, when decoding, the first part of the header that meets the common arrangement rule is first found: a dot pattern of "─" type arrangement; on the basis of identifying the first part of the header, the second part of the header is found using the non-common arrangement rule. If it satisfies the "|" type arrangement, the header is an "L" type header, and the first image pointer is determined to be the image pointer of the "L" type header. If it satisfies the "/" type arrangement, the header is a "7" type header, and the first image pointer is determined to be the image pointer of the "7" type header. Furthermore, the size of the first image pointer can be determined based on the arrangement rules of the micro-image units in the header of the first image pointer and the number of dot patterns in the header, and the type of the first image pointer can be determined, and decoding can be completed according to the arrangement rules of the content data corresponding to the type of the first image pointer.

在解碼過程中,由於在介質表面圖像中第一圖像指標的範圍內除了包括微圖像單元的點狀圖案外,還可能存在印刷污點或光學殘像,因此在解碼過程中可以根據第一圖像指標所屬類型對應的微圖像單元排列規則,從第一圖像指標的範圍內篩選出滿足第一圖像指標所屬類型對應的微圖像單元排列規則的微圖像單元的點狀圖案進行解碼,而篩除印刷污點、光學殘像。 In the decoding process, since the first image indicator in the medium surface image includes not only the dot pattern of the micro-image unit, but also printing stains or optical residual images, the dot pattern of the micro-image unit that meets the arrangement rule of the micro-image unit corresponding to the type to which the first image indicator belongs can be selected from the range of the first image indicator in the decoding process according to the arrangement rule of the micro-image unit corresponding to the type to which the first image indicator belongs, and the printing stains and optical residual images can be filtered out.

在一種可選實施例中,如圖5所示,介質表面500包括功能區501和手寫區502,其中功能區501和手寫區502中均承載有圖像指標(圖中未示出)。其中功能區501中可以為點讀區,也可提供多種功能,包括但不限於:點讀功能、手寫功能、保存功能等等,若確定圖像掃描裝置當前位於功能區501,也即圖像掃描裝置掃描到了功能區501某一功能的圖像指標,則在對圖像指標解碼後根據解碼結果確定對應的目標功能,並執行目標功能對應的指令;而手寫區502則用於通過圖像掃描裝置進行手寫。 In an optional embodiment, as shown in FIG5 , the medium surface 500 includes a function area 501 and a handwriting area 502, wherein both the function area 501 and the handwriting area 502 carry image pointers (not shown in the figure). The function area 501 may be a point-reading area, and may also provide multiple functions, including but not limited to: point-reading function, handwriting function, saving function, etc. If it is determined that the image scanning device is currently located in the function area 501, that is, the image scanning device scans the image pointer of a function of the function area 501, then after decoding the image pointer, the corresponding target function is determined according to the decoding result, and the instruction corresponding to the target function is executed; and the handwriting area 502 is used for handwriting through the image scanning device.

可選的,功能區中的圖像指標與手寫區中的圖像指標可採用不同類型的圖像指標,例如功能區採用第一種類型的圖像指標,手寫區採用第二種類型的圖像指標,從而可以直接根據圖像指標的類型區分功能區和手寫區;可選的,在功能區中的圖像指標與手寫區中的圖像指標可採用不同類型的圖像指標的基礎上,第一種類型的圖像指標的解碼結果可以對應第一預設碼段,第二種類型的圖像指標的解碼結果可以對應第二預設碼段,例如第一種類型的圖像指標和第二種類型的圖像指標總共有1萬個,其 中碼段0~2999對應第一種類型的圖像指標,碼段3000~9999對應第二種類型的圖像指標,因此也可基於解碼結果所在的碼段來區分功能區和手寫區;當然功能區中的圖像指標與手寫區中的圖像指標也可採用相同類型的圖像指標,可通過圖像指標的解碼結果所在的碼段來區分功能區和手寫區,例如功能區和手寫區採用相同類型的圖像指標總共有1萬個,其中碼段0~2999設定為功能區的圖像指標,碼段3000~9999設定為手寫區的圖像指標。 Optionally, the image pointer in the function area and the image pointer in the handwriting area may use different types of image pointers, for example, the function area uses a first type of image pointer, and the handwriting area uses a second type of image pointer, so that the function area and the handwriting area can be directly distinguished according to the type of image pointer; Optionally, on the basis that the image pointer in the function area and the image pointer in the handwriting area can use different types of image pointers, the decoding result of the first type of image pointer can correspond to the first preset code segment, and the decoding result of the second type of image pointer can correspond to the second preset code segment, for example, the total number of the first type of image pointer and the second type of image pointer is 10,000, of which code segments 0~2999 correspond to the first type of image pointers, and code segments 3000~9999 correspond to the second type of image pointers. Therefore, the functional area and the handwriting area can also be distinguished based on the code segment where the decoding result is located; of course, the image pointers in the functional area and the image pointers in the handwriting area can also use the same type of image pointers, and the functional area and the handwriting area can be distinguished by the code segment where the decoding result of the image pointer is located. For example, there are a total of 10,000 image pointers of the same type used in the functional area and the handwriting area, of which code segments 0~2999 are set as image pointers for the functional area, and code segments 3000~9999 are set as image pointers for the handwriting area.

方式一:根據該第一圖像指標的類型,判斷該圖像掃描裝置當前是否位於該手寫區,其中該功能區中的圖像指標與該手寫區中的圖像指標採用不同類型的圖像指標; Method 1: judging whether the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area according to the type of the first image pointer, wherein the image pointer in the function area and the image pointer in the handwriting area use different types of image pointers;

其中,由於功能區中的圖像指標與手寫區中的圖像指標採用不同類型的圖像指標,因此圖像掃描裝置在掃描第一圖像指標時可以直接根據第一圖像指標的類型判斷圖像掃描裝置當前處於手寫區還是功能區。 Among them, since the image pointer in the function area and the image pointer in the handwriting area use different types of image pointers, the image scanning device can directly judge whether the image scanning device is currently in the handwriting area or the function area according to the type of the first image pointer when scanning the first image pointer.

方式二:根據該第一圖像指標、以及與該第一圖像指標相鄰 的第二圖像指標之間的關係,判斷該圖像掃描裝置當前是否位於該手寫區; Method 2: Based on the relationship between the first image pointer and the second image pointer adjacent to the first image pointer, determine whether the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area;

手寫區中的圖像指標由於需要提供座標,因此相鄰的圖像指標不相同,且相鄰的圖像指標之間滿足一定規則,記為第一預設規則,第一預設規則為手寫區內相鄰圖像指標間的排列規則,例如相鄰的圖像指標的某些微圖像單元存在一定的相對位置關係。若第一圖像指標相鄰的第二圖像指標與第一圖像指標不同、且第一圖像指標與第二圖像指標之間符合第一預設規則,則確定圖像掃描裝置當前位於手寫區。 Since the image pointers in the handwriting area need to provide coordinates, the adjacent image pointers are different, and the adjacent image pointers meet certain rules, which are recorded as the first preset rules. The first preset rule is the arrangement rule between adjacent image pointers in the handwriting area, for example, some micro-image units of adjacent image pointers have a certain relative position relationship. If the second image pointer adjacent to the first image pointer is different from the first image pointer, and the first image pointer and the second image pointer meet the first preset rule, it is determined that the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area.

方式三:根據該解碼結果所在的碼段以及預設碼段,判斷該圖像掃描裝置當前是否位於該手寫區。 Method 3: Based on the code segment where the decoding result is located and the preset code segment, determine whether the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area.

其中,功能區中的圖像指標與手寫區中的圖像指標可採用不同類型的圖像指標,也可採用相同類型的圖像指標,在這兩種情況中,均可針對于功能區中的圖像指標與手寫區中的圖像指標,可以預先配置功能區中的圖像指標和手寫區中圖像指標對應的碼段,例如第一預設碼段為手寫區內圖像指標的解碼結果對應的碼段,再如第二預設碼段為非手寫區(除了手寫區外的區域,包括功能區)內圖像指標的解碼結果對應的碼段,若第一圖像指標的解碼結果落入第一預設碼段,則確定圖像掃描裝置當前位於手寫區,或者,若第一圖像指標的解碼結果未落入第二預設碼段,則確定圖像掃描裝置當前位於手寫區。 The image pointer in the function area and the image pointer in the handwriting area may be of different types or of the same type. In both cases, the image pointer in the function area and the image pointer in the handwriting area may be configured with code segments corresponding to the image pointer in the function area and the image pointer in the handwriting area in advance. For example, the first preset code segment is the decoded result of the image pointer in the handwriting area. For example, if the second preset code segment is the code segment corresponding to the decoding result of the image pointer in the non-handwriting area (the area other than the handwriting area, including the function area), if the decoding result of the first image pointer falls into the first preset code segment, it is determined that the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area, or if the decoding result of the first image pointer does not fall into the second preset code segment, it is determined that the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area.

方式四:根據該圖像掃描裝置是否已在該功能區中選取手寫識別功能,判斷該圖像掃描裝置當前是否位於該手寫區。 Method 4: Determine whether the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area based on whether the image scanning device has selected the handwriting recognition function in the function area.

其中,功能區中包括手寫識別功能,圖像掃描裝置在掃描第 一圖像指標之前,若用戶需要啟動手寫識別功能,則可操作電子設備,使圖像掃描裝置掃描功能區中手寫識別功能中包括的圖像指標,從而觸發啟動手寫識別功能,之後再掃描到第一圖像指標可確認圖像掃描裝置當前位於手寫區。 Among them, the function area includes a handwriting recognition function. Before the image scanning device scans the first image pointer, if the user needs to activate the handwriting recognition function, the electronic device can be operated to make the image scanning device scan the image pointer included in the handwriting recognition function in the function area, thereby triggering the activation of the handwriting recognition function, and then scanning the first image pointer to confirm that the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area.

方式五:根據該第一圖像指標中的特定微圖像單元或該第一標頭部的微圖像單元排列規則,判斷該圖像掃描裝置當前是否位於該手寫區。 Method 5: Determine whether the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area based on the specific micro-image unit in the first image pointer or the arrangement rule of the micro-image unit in the first header.

其中,可在圖像指標中某一特定微圖像單元採用特定的編碼規則,來區分該圖像指標位於手寫區或非手寫區(包括功能區),例如該特定微圖像單元中的點狀圖案向特定方向偏移,如手寫區的圖像指標中該特定微圖像單元的點狀圖案向在上下方向發生偏移,功能區的圖像指標中該特定微圖像單元的點狀圖案向在左右方向發生偏移。 Among them, a specific encoding rule can be used in a specific micro-image unit in the image pointer to distinguish whether the image pointer is located in the handwriting area or the non-handwriting area (including the functional area). For example, the dot pattern in the specific micro-image unit is offset in a specific direction, such as the dot pattern of the specific micro-image unit in the image pointer of the handwriting area is offset in the up and down direction, and the dot pattern of the specific micro-image unit in the image pointer of the functional area is offset in the left and right direction.

進一步的,若第一圖像指標中的特定微圖像單元符合第一編碼規則,則確定圖像掃描裝置當前位於手寫區,其中第一編碼規則為手寫區內圖像指標的特定微圖像單元的排列規則;或者,若第一圖像指標中的特定微圖像單元不符合第二編碼規則,則確定圖像掃描裝置當前位於手寫區,其中第二編碼規則為非手寫區內圖像指標的特定微圖像單元的排列規則。 Furthermore, if the specific micro-image unit in the first image pointer meets the first coding rule, it is determined that the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area, wherein the first coding rule is the arrangement rule of the specific micro-image unit of the image pointer in the handwriting area; or, if the specific micro-image unit in the first image pointer does not meet the second coding rule, it is determined that the image scanning device is currently located in the handwriting area, wherein the second coding rule is the arrangement rule of the specific micro-image unit of the image pointer in the non-handwriting area.

在上述任一實施例的基礎上,電子設備在實現點讀功能時,需要將點讀內容(多媒體內容資料)預先儲存於電子設備中,會存在無法更新的缺點,需要以記憶卡寄送,會存在不相容且不易保管的問題,或者電子設備通過電腦聯機到網路下載,會有電腦以及操作能力的要求,因此 本實施例中,可以將聯網資訊如服務集識別碼SSID和密碼password等作為圖像指標的解碼結果,進而根據聯網資訊後進行聯網。具體的,在對第一圖像指標進行解碼後,若解碼結果為預設聯網資訊,則根據聯網資訊與目標網路設備(如無線接入點AP、路由器Router等)建立網路連接。 On the basis of any of the above embodiments, when the electronic device realizes the click-to-read function, the click-to-read content (multimedia content data) needs to be stored in the electronic device in advance, which will have the disadvantage of being unable to update, and needs to be sent with a memory card, which will cause incompatibility and difficult to store problems, or the electronic device is connected to the Internet through a computer to download, which will require a computer and operating capabilities, so In this embodiment, the networking information such as the service set identifier SSID and the password password can be used as the decoding result of the image indicator, and then the network is connected according to the networking information. Specifically, after decoding the first image indicator, if the decoding result is the default networking information, a network connection is established with the target network device (such as a wireless access point AP, a router Router, etc.) according to the networking information.

可選的,也可通過電子設備的手寫功能書寫聯網資訊,在對移動軌跡識別後,得到聯網資訊,並進行語音播放,經過用戶確認後,可根據聯網資訊與目標網路設備(如無線接入點AP、路由器Router等)建立網路連接。 Optionally, the network information can be written through the handwriting function of the electronic device. After the mobile track is identified, the network information is obtained and voice is played. After confirmation by the user, a network connection can be established with the target network device (such as wireless access point AP, router, etc.) based on the network information.

在上述實施例的基礎上,在電子設備聯網後,可對所需的多媒體內容資料進行下載,並儲存在電子設備中。可選的,為了指示電子設備所需下載的多媒體內容資料,可在介質表面以第一類型的圖像指標標識多媒體內容資料的資訊,例如多媒體內容資料的名稱、系列、標識(ID)等,而點讀區域採用第二類型的圖像指標,與多媒體內容資料對應,第一類型的圖像指標與第二類型的圖像指標的編碼架構不同,即標頭區的點狀圖案的排列方式或布點原則及/或矩形陣列的點狀圖案的數量不同等。 Based on the above embodiments, after the electronic device is connected to the network, the required multimedia content data can be downloaded and stored in the electronic device. Optionally, in order to indicate the multimedia content data that the electronic device needs to download, the information of the multimedia content data, such as the name, series, identification (ID) of the multimedia content data, can be identified on the surface of the medium with a first type of image indicator, and the click-to-read area uses a second type of image indicator, corresponding to the multimedia content data. The first type of image indicator and the second type of image indicator have different coding structures, that is, the arrangement mode or layout principle of the dot pattern in the header area and/or the number of dot patterns in the rectangular array are different.

電子設備通過圖像掃描裝置採集介質表面圖像,執行上述S401-S404所述方法得到解碼結果,若解碼結果為多媒體內容資料的資訊,則通過網路連接下載對應的多媒體內容資料,並將進行儲存;而在電子設備進行點讀時,也即電子設備通過圖像掃描裝置在點讀區域採集介質表面圖像,執行上述S401-S404所述方法得到解碼結果,將解碼結果對應的多媒體內容資料進行播放。 The electronic device collects the medium surface image through the image scanning device, executes the method described in S401-S404 above to obtain the decoding result, and if the decoding result is the information of the multimedia content data, the corresponding multimedia content data is downloaded through the network connection and stored; when the electronic device is reading, that is, the electronic device collects the medium surface image in the reading area through the image scanning device, executes the method described in S401-S404 above to obtain the decoding result, and plays the multimedia content data corresponding to the decoding result.
